About the Organisation
World Trumpet Mission (WTM) is a global Christian organization dedicated to mobilizing prayer, evangelism, and spiritual revival with a mission to prepare the nations for the coming of the Lord through transformational ministry, leadership development, and community outreach. Founded in Uganda and now reaching continents worldwide, WTM has earned recognition for its passionate commitment to empowering churches, raising intercessors, and uniting believers across denominations to spark holistic societal change through the Gospel.
Its work culture emphasizes spiritual growth, servant leadership, collaboration, and a deep sense of calling, offering team members a purpose-driven environment with opportunities to serve through both local and international missions, training programs, and administrative roles. With a flexible structure that integrates both volunteer and full-time positions, WTM continues to evolve through strategic partnerships, media outreach, and grassroots mobilization to foster spiritual awakening and societal transformation.
The mission’s model blends faith-based innovation with practical community development, expanding its reach across Africa, Europe, the Americas, and Asia. Rooted in core values such as faith, integrity, unity, humility, and compassion, WTM also champions Corporate Social Responsibility by addressing social issues like poverty, education, and health through its outreach initiatives. Job Description
Job Title: Administrator
Organisation: World Trumpet Mission (WTM)
Duty Station: Seguku, Wakiso, Uganda
The Administrator plays a pivotal role in ensuring the smooth operation of WTM’s administrative functions, supporting ministry activities, and maintaining organizational efficiency. The Church Administrator will support the ministry’s programs and missions by managing resources effectively, coordinating church operations, and upholding ethical and spiritual values in administration.
Duties, Roles and Responsibilities
Administrative Leadership & Church Operations
Oversee and manage all administrative functions, ensuring operational efficiency across departments.
Implement policies and procedures that enhance church operations, facilities management, and service delivery.
Ensure proper maintenance and utilization of organizational assets, including equipment and infrastructure.
Supervise administrative and support staff, fostering a culture of excellence and accountability.
Manage church facilities, ensuring cleanliness, security, and proper maintenance.
Support mission programs by providing logistical and operational coordination.
Financial Management & Resource Stewardship
Work with finance teams to develop and manage the church budget.
Ensure efficient resource allocation and cost-effectiveness in operations.
Support fundraising initiatives and donor reporting, ensuring financial transparency
Coordinate fundraising activities and manage donor contributions effectively.
Human Resource & Team Management
Supervise administrative staff, providing mentorship and professional development.
Ensure proper recruitment, training, and retention of church personnel.
Develop and enforce workplace ethics and Christian values in the organization.
Stakeholder Engagement & Communication
Serve as a point of contact between WTM leadership, church members, and external stakeholders.
Manage internal communication, ensuring timely dissemination of important information.
Facilitate meetings, prepare reports, and assist in decision-making processes.
Build relationships with partner organizations, suppliers, and service providers.
Compliance, Legal & Risk Management
Ensure the church complies with local laws, tax regulations, and governance policies.
Manage contracts, legal agreements, and church property documentation.
Identify potential risks and implement measures to safeguard the church’s operations.
Qualifications, Education and Competencies
A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Theology, Organizational Leadership, Finance, or a related field.
A Master’s degree in Administration, Leadership, or Theology is an added advantage.
Experience:
Minimum 5–7 years of experience in church administration, nonprofit management, or business administration.
Strong background in finance, human resource management, and operations within a faith-based organization.
Proven experience in handling church finances, managing teams, and coordinating programs.
Experience working with church leaders, ministries, and mission-based organizations.
Competencies
Ministry & Leadership Competencies
Spiritual Maturity & Leadership – Strong Christian faith and commitment to Christian values.
Operational Efficiency – Ability to streamline administrative processes for better service delivery.
Strategic Thinking – Capable of aligning administration with ministry goals.
Stakeholder Management – Strong ability to engage with church leaders, staff, and external partners.
Communication & Public Relations – Effective in written and verbal communication, including reporting.
Cultural Sensitivity – Ability to work in diverse teams and environments.
Business & Operational Competencies
Financial Management – Proficiency in budgeting, financial reporting, and resource allocation.
Planning, Organizing, and Coordinating – Ability to manage church activities and events efficiently.
Project & Facilities Management – Ability to oversee estates, equipment, and church assets.
Legal & Compliance Knowledge – Understanding of regulatory frameworks affecting administration.
Problem-Solving & Decision-Making – Analytical skills to assess challenges and implement solutions.
Mentoring & Supervision – Ability to lead and develop administrative staff effectively.
Time Management & Meeting Deadlines – Strong organizational skills to prioritize tasks effectively.
Negotiation Skills – Ability to manage contracts and church agreements professionally.
Commercial & Business Awareness – Understanding of financial sustainability in ministry operations
